The cost of relocating the adult use. <br /> <br />9.11.14 Compliance. In order to assure compliance with the performance standards set <br />forth above, the Council may require the owner or operator of any permitted use to make such <br />investigations and tests as may be required to show adherence to above performance standards. <br />Such investigation and tests as are required to be made shall be carried out by an independent <br />testing organization as may be agreed upon by the City and the owner or operator, or if there is <br />failure to agree within ten days after written notice by the City to the owner or operator to make <br />such investigation and tests, by such independent testing organization as may be selected by the <br />Council. The costs incurred in having such investigations or tests conducted shall be borne <br />entirely by the owner or operator. The procedure stated above shall not preclude the City from <br />taking any such other tests and investigations it finds appropriate to determine compliance with <br />these performance standards. <br /> <br />SECTION 3. SUMMARY <br /> <br />The following official summary of Ordinance #03-30 has been approved by the City Council of <br />the City of Ramsey as clearly informing the public of the intent and effect of the Ordinance. <br /> <br />It is the intent and effect of Ordinance #03-30 to amend Ramsey City Code Chapter 9 (Zoning <br />and Subdivision of Land), Subsection 9.11 (Performance Standards) to update Subsections <br />9.11.02 General Provisions, 9.11.02 Accessory Uses, 9.11.04 Home Occupations, 9.11.07 <br />Nuisances, 9.11.10 Off-Street Parking, 9.11.13 Off-Street Parking, and 9.11.14 Off-Street <br />Loading; and to eliminate Subsections 9.11.03 Conforming Use Designation and Existing Uses <br />in the "4 in 40" Density District, 9.11.08 Driveways, 9.11.09 Screening, 9.11.11 Traffic Control, <br />9.11.12 Soil Erosion, 9.11.16 Height Regulations, 9.11.17 Fences, 9.11.20 Non-Residential <br />Development Standards. No amendments were made to Subsections 9.11.05 Manufactured <br />Housing, 9.11.06 Incineration Burning, 9.11.15 Permitted Encroachments, 9.11.18 Grading, <br />Mining and Filling Permits, and 9.11.19 Adult Uses. <br /> <br />SECTION 4. EFFECTIVE DATE <br /> <br />The effective date of this ordinance is thirty (30) days after its passage and publication, subject to <br />City Charter Section 5.07. <br /> <br />Adopted by the Ramsey City Council the 12th day of August 2003. <br /> <br />Mayor <br /> <br />27 <br /> <br /> <br />
